Celebrating the 2025 Chloe Munro Scholarship recipients
From an incredible 95 applicants, ten outstanding women have been selected for the 2025 Chloe Munro Scholarship for Transformational Leadership. Honouring the legacy of the late Chloe Munro AO, the program continues to empower women to become impactful leaders in clean energy.

The Best Practice Charter for Renewable Energy Projects has seen more than 50 Clean Energy Council members commit to engaging respectfully with the communities in which they plan and operate projects, to be sensitive to environmental and cultural values and to make a positive contribution to the regions.
